3678 results
Egypt
English, Arabic
United Kingdom
English
United Kingdom
English
Kenya
English, French, Russian, Japanese, Swahili
Lebanon
English, Arabic
Pakistan
English, Arabic, Hindi, Urdu, Punjabi
Ukraine
English, Russian, Spanish, Italian, Ukrainian
Philippines
English, Tagalog
United Kingdom
English
Serbia
English, Russian, Serbian
United Kingdom
English
Egypt
English, Arabic
United Kingdom
English
Poland
English, Polish
Italy
English, Italian
Georgia
English
Pakistan
English, Arabic, Urdu
Egypt
English, Arabic
Canada
English, Spanish, Persian/Farsi
Russia
English, Russian